The men and women of that generation are really unlike any other.
Try being a doughboy or any other WW1 soldier and being forced to run across open ground to the other sides trench while being destroyed by machine guns and artillery fire. Which is all due to outdated tactics. For the Battle of The Somme tens of thousands of British soldiers became casualties on the first day. The people in WW2 had it far better than the boys of the first world war.

The war with Russia was going badly before D-Day. After that battle Germany was doomed in the Eastern Front. Even if D-Day failed the chances of Germany winning were low at that point. D-Day did put a good nail in the coffin but an Allied victory was going to happen either way.
